let on
英 [let ɒn]
美 [let ɑːn]
透露; 泄露
柯林斯词典
- PHRASAL VERB 透露;泄露
If you do notlet onthat something is true, you do not tell anyone that it is true, and you keep it a secret.- She never let on that anything was wrong...
她从来没有透露过有什么不妥。 - I didn't let on to the staff what my conversation was...
我没有将谈话内容向员工们透露。 - He knows the culprit but is not letting on.
他知道罪犯是谁,但却闭口不说。
